[Buildroot] [PATCH 2/7 v4] support/dependencies: check for system-provided bison and flex

Yann E. MORIN yann.morin.1998 at free.fr
Fri Aug 17 16:06:48 UTC 2018


Signed-off-by: "Yann E. MORIN" <yann.morin.1998 at free.fr>
Cc: Thomas Petazzoni <thomas.petazzoni at bootlin.com>
Cc: Arnout Vandecappelle <arnout at mind.be>
---
 support/dependencies/check-host-bison-flex.mk | 10 ++++++++++
 1 file changed, 10 insertions(+)
 create mode 100644 support/dependencies/check-host-bison-flex.mk

diff --git a/support/dependencies/check-host-bison-flex.mk b/support/dependencies/check-host-bison-flex.mk
new file mode 100644
index 0000000000..233b6c51cc
--- /dev/null
+++ b/support/dependencies/check-host-bison-flex.mk
@@ -0,0 +1,10 @@
+# If the system lacks bison or flex, add
+# dependencies to suitable host packages
+
+ifeq ($(shell which bison 2>/dev/null),)
+BR2_BISON_HOST_DEPENDENCY = host-bison
+endif
+
+ifeq ($(shell which flex 2>/dev/null),)
+BR2_FLEX_HOST_DEPENDENCY = host-flex
+endif
-- 
2.14.1




More information about the buildroot mailing list